Job overview

An exciting opportunity has arisen for an enthusiastic and motivated pharmacist to develop specialist skills within our Infection & Immunity team, working across HIV, Sexual Health and Hepatitis C services. You will join a supportive multidisciplinary team and play a key role in delivering innovative, patient-centred care while contributing to the ongoing development of the service.

You will be responsible for:

  • Delivering patient-centred clinical pharmacy services in both inpatient and outpatient settings.
  • Providing clinical oversight of the HIV home delivery service.
  • Supporting the provision of high quality, patient centered pharmacy services to GUM/Sexual reproductive health and Hepatitis C
  • Leading and contributing to audit, quality improvement projects and service reviews.
  • Supporting the education and development of pharmacy staff.

The post holder will support the Highly Specialist Pharmacist in directorate work, audit and research. This role combines advanced clinical practice and leadership responsibilities, providing specialist advice to patients and the multidisciplinary team to optimise medicines use and support adherence

We are seeking a self-motivated and experienced clinical pharmacist with excellent organisational, communication, and interpersonal skills.

Main duties of the job

The post holder will support the Network Lead Pharmacist and Highly Specialist Pharmacist for Infection and Immunity in promoting high quality, cost-effective and safe prescribing. The post holder will provide clinical pharmacy support to the Infection and Immunity departments across the Trust. The post holder will participate in education and training of Pharmacy staff rotating in the Infection and Immunity pharmacy team at Bart’s Health, and will assist in the provision and development of clinical pharmacy services within the service

The post holder will be responsible for providing patient-focused pharmaceutical care, defined as the responsible provision of medication to achieve definite outcomes that improve patients’ quality of life. The post holder is to communicate effectively with patients and the wider MDT to optimise their pharmaceutical management through liaising with other healthcare professions to design, implement and monitor therapeutic plans to optimise clinical outcomes, minimise adverse reactions and improve medicines safety.
